The Flying Fortress. A name that conjures up images of brave young men conducting daylight raids deep in enemy territory, far from home. The B-17 was bristling with defensive weapons and could also carry a heavy bomb load to distant locations. It rapidly became the symbol of US air power of early 1940s. We take you inside the B-17F to expose how it worked, how it was operated and the tactics that made it a formidable offensive and defensive weapon. It’s reputation and achievements have made the B-17 one of the most iconic and recognizable aircraft in the history of aviation.

9:15 That's not how the Norden bombsight worked. The bombardier would keep the target in his sight the entire time on the approach by adjusting 2 knobs (for course and rate). When the correct position was reached to release the bombs, the sight itself would trigger the drop, not the bombardier. This is consistently being portrayed wrong in media, but I was hoping at least you guys would get it right.
